Job Description
AECOM is seeking a Senior Civil Engineering Specialist to join our Environmental Remediation team in Franklin, TN. The successful candidate will work with a diverse team of technical leaders across a broad range of practice areas delivering professional consulting services to our key clients.
The successful candidate will provide technical skills supporting Environmental Remediation and Coal Ash closure projects within the department and will develop strong relationships with the team and clients to enable pursuit of new opportunities. The successful candidate will have the ability to communicate effectively with members of the project team, clients, site personnel and office management, and work both independently and as part of a project team.
The successful candidate will be committed to the team's success and growth; will rigorously apply safety policies and procedures; will manage the cost and schedule elements of project delivery; and will effectively manage the quality of field efforts and project deliverables within the bounds of the AECOM Quality Management System.
The job responsibilities of this position include, but are not limited to the following:
- Work collaboratively with the Remediation team Project Managers and professionals within other AECOM business lines.
- Function as Senior Civil Engineering Specialist working on projects with various levels of complexity, responsible for delivery, design, schedule, client liaison, reporting requirements, and coordination with project team members.
- Prepare designs, reports, specifications, and cost estimates for civil and environmental remediation projects , including material excavation and handling, landfill design and construction, dewatering and water treatment, stormwater management, site restoration, environmental permitting, municipal site plans, and similar large scale projects.
- Work in Computer Aided Design (CAD) applications with technical staff. Strong knowledge or experience in Autodesk Civil 3D experience preferred.
- Proactively identify opportunities to increase project efficiencies, improve technical methodologies and add value to client service offerings.
- Mentor junior civil technicians and engineers
Qualifications
M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S:
- BA/BS in Civil or Environmental Engineering + 6 years of related experience or demonstrated equivalency of experience and/or education. or AA/AS (US) + 8 years of related experience or demonstrated equivalency of experience and/or education.
- 6+ years in remediation related work, including design, surveying and construction related activities
- 6+ years related management experience.
- Valid U.S Driver's License and as a condition of employment, must pass AECOM's Motor Vehicle Records Review.
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:
- 10+ years of relevant experience at an engineering and construction industry.
- Ability to proactively lead technical efforts and project team staff.
- Experience as Senior Project Engineer on large scale projects, including landfills, material excavation and dewatering, and coal ash closure.
- OSHA 40-hour HAZWOPER training certification.
